É possível salvar dados do Arduino em um módulo de memória de cartão
É possível salvar dados do Arduino em um módulo de memória de cartão
Eu gostaria de construir o computador mais simples possível. Eu não me importo com velocidade ou armazenamento, na verdade, ter velocidade lenta e armazenamento baixo é uma enorme vantagem, pois quero construí-lo a partir de transistores (idealmente, relés!) E quero um LED para cada estado. Ele...
Eu me preocupo que isso possa ser sinalizado como muito amplo, mas aqui vai: Ultimamente, tenho pensado na possibilidade de carregar dados em dispositivos periféricos. Um dos periféricos mais utilizados é o mouse. Percebo que existem 101 maneiras de construir um mouse. Para refinar minha pergunta...
Pode ser apenas uma coincidência, mas notei que os microcontroladores que usei foram reiniciados quando a RAM ficou sem memória (o Atmega 328, se específico do hardware). É isso que os microcontroladores fazem quando ficam sem memória? Se não, o que acontece então? Porque como? O ponteiro da pilha...
Com grandes quantidades de variáveis de texto, achei necessário armazená-las na memória Flash usando PROGMEM . Quais são as consequências positivas e negativas do armazenamento de grandes variáveis no Flash (usando PROGMEM) vs SRAM vs EEPROM no
Em um microprocessador com gerenciamento de TLB de hardware (por exemplo, um Intel x86-64), se ocorrer uma falha no TLB e o processador estiver percorrendo a tabela de páginas, são esses acessos de memória (sem chip) passando pela hierarquia de cache (L1, L2, etc.
Preciso de uma solução de memória que seja usada para acompanhar uma contagem acumulada em um projeto baseado em microcontrolador. Por contagem acumulada, quero dizer que o microcontrolador usa esse local de memória para manter a contagem da ocorrência de um evento. A contagem precisa ser...
Estou tentando me comunicar com uma FRAM conectada remotamente (FM24C04 da Ramtron) usando o I2C. Essa memória é incorporada em uma placa que pode ser inserida e removida a qualquer momento para / do sistema (a comunicação é finalizada corretamente antes da remoção da memória). O problema é: logo...
Eu tenho um design usando um LPC1788 junto com um módulo SDRAM do ISSI ( IS42S32800D ). Esta é uma interface de 32 bits. Encaminhei esse projeto e tive um protótipo feito com um fabricante de PCBs que faz protótipos de 6 camadas. O protótipo PCB funciona bem. Então, pensei em obter o PCB fabricado...
Estou usando o controlador TM4C1230C3PMI do instrumento Texas em um dos meus projetos. Possui 32 KB de flash interno, o que não é suficiente para o meu aplicativo. Microcontroladores com tamanho de flash maior estão disponíveis no mercado que podem ser usados, mas eu quero usar apenas este...
Estou tentando usar a ram celular na placa de desenvolvimento do Nexys 4 FPGA . Estou usando o Xilinx Vivado e gostaria que um processador de núcleo leve Microblaze fosse capaz de executar leituras e gravações. Até agora eu criei o processador em um design de bloco. Depois de muita procura na...
O título diz tudo. Estou tentando entender o funcionamento das tecnologias de memória flash, no nível do transistor. Após algumas pesquisas, obtive boas intuições sobre transistores de porta flutuante e como injetar elétrons ou removê-los da célula. Eu sou do CS, então minha compreensão de...
Se você vir o manual de referência do STM32f103, poderá ver três modos de inicialização. bem, qual é o uso do modo de inicialização três? por favor me diga por exemplo para cada
O HDD funciona de maneira parcialmente sequencial. No entanto, a RAM é conhecida pelo acesso aleatório à memória, permitindo velocidade igual de acesso à memória para todos os locais e todas as vezes. Então, o que torna a RAM tão especial? Como funciona o acesso aleatório à memória? (Eu sei que a...
Estou usando um microcontrolador PowerPC em escala livre. No módulo de memória flash da folha de dados, o número de "estados de espera do acesso à memória flash" é configurável. A seguir, a parte da folha de dados que foi levantada, foi retirada da descrição do registro dos registros do módulo...
Isso deve ser bem simples, mas meu google-ing não está aparecendo nada ... Posso criar meu projeto com êxito no TI Code Composer Studio (CCSv5) e direcionar meu dispositivo. Agora, quero saber o tamanho do código do meu programa, para saber quanto espaço tenho para crescimento futuro, etc. Quando...
Seria bom se essa fosse uma pergunta de compras - mas é mais de 99% provável que seja uma questão de construção eletrônica :-(. Desejo encontrar a maneira mais rápida / fácil / barata de ler um NAND Flash IC de 4 GB em um cartão de memória USB danificado. O IC integrado do controlador está morto....
Estou projetando um dispositivo que ajusta automaticamente sua posição física à medida que a temperatura muda. Se o dispositivo foi desligado ou a energia foi desconectada, o dispositivo precisa se lembrar da última temperatura e posição. Tenho a capacidade de armazenar esses valores na EEPROM, mas...
Como posso usar malloc()e free()funções em um PIC? Eu verifiquei o stdlib.hcabeçalho e não há menção a eles. Estou usando o MCC18. Alguém já teve que usá-los? Preciso deles porque estou portando uma biblioteca do Windows XP para o PIC. O guia de portabilidade diz para adaptar as funções...
Os processadores x86 modernos têm pelo menos 512 K de cache L2. Existem aplicativos que cabem inteiramente nessa quantidade de memória. Você pode executar esses chips sem RAM anexada? Em caso afirmativo, existe uma maneira de fazê-lo que elimine a penalidade de tempo de write-back quando a CPU...